This role involves conducting hearings and making determinations on applications for the correction of real property tax assessments, including valuation determinations related to the City's new non-primary residence surcharge. The position requires evaluating the credibility and weight of information presented in support of applications. Responsibilities include research, analysis, and valuation of all property types, including complex and high-value properties, for administrative assessment review. Determinations may utilize any of the three recognized approaches to real property appraisal. The role may also involve supervising, coordinating, and assigning work to subordinate employees, and conducting physical property inspections when necessary. Additionally, the position requires attending outreach sessions to educate property owners and real estate representatives about the NYC Real Property Assessment System and conducting virtual and in-person hearings with legal representatives and property owners at the Department of Finance. Candidates must be proficient in Microsoft Office applications (Excel, Outlook, Teams, SharePoint, Word).
